Germany, SS. A SS-Issued Patriotic Badge by Otto Gahr, with Case
(SS Abzeichen). This is an extremely unique and well-preserved example of a SS-issued decorative gift badge by Otto Gahr, constructed of silver. The obverse depicts a central, richly-detailed ship with crew visible on the deck and sails deployed, on top of stylized waves. The ship is in turn circumscribed by a detailed wave design. The reverse is plain with the exception of engraved double sig runes of the SS, a barrel hinge, a horizontal pinback, and a round wire catch. The badge measures 38.63 mm in diameter and weighs 5.5 grams. It is accompanied by its period original case of issue, constructed of heavy cardstock with a faux blue leather exterior. It features a white satin-type lid liner with an intact hinge cover, recessed blue felt medal bed, functional magnetic metal spring catch with exterior stud release, and functional magnetic metal hinge. The lid liner is stamped with a maker’s mark of “Gahr, München”, for the firm of Otto and Karolina Gahr, along with the double sig runes of the SS. The case measures 71 mm (w) x 71 mm (l). In overall extremely fine condition.
